Soft XL Technology Services (P) Ltd

Soft XL Technology Services (P) Ltd

D1-D4, Pamba
Techno Park Campus
Thiruvananthapuram 695581

+91-471-2527627

+91-471-2416970

Related Companies

Business Reviews for Soft XL Technology Services (P) Ltd